About

Fernando J. Pantusin is a rising researcher at the intersection of robotics, digital twin technology, and engineering education. His work centers on making robotic systems more accessible and practical through virtual environments and active learning methodologies. Pantusin’s most cited paper, “Virtual Teleoperation System for Mobile Manipulator Robots Focused on Object Transport and Manipulation” (2024, 7 citations), introduces a novel teleoperation tool built in Unity that integrates kinematic and dynamic models, enabling precise control of mobile manipulators for object transport tasks. Building on this, his 2025 work, “Digital Twin Integration for Active Learning in Robotic Manipulator Control Within Engineering 4.0” (6 citations), tackles a critical barrier in STEM education: the high cost and risk of physical robots. By developing a Digital Twin-based training platform, Pantusin empowers students to learn robotic manipulator control through immersive, risk-free simulation—a key contribution to Engineering 4.0 pedagogy. Though early in his career, his focus on bridging virtual and physical robotics has already garnered attention, with his papers cited in emerging discussions on teleoperation and educational innovation. Pantusin’s work promises to shape how future engineers interact with and learn from robotic systems.
